By size

Tankless water heater installation by flow rate (GPM): Brentwood vs Sparks

Tankless units are sized by flow rate — gallons per minute (GPM) — rather than tank size. Add up the fixtures you'd run at once: a shower is ~2 GPM, so a larger household needs a higher-GPM unit (or two).

SizeBrentwoodSparks
5–7 GPM (1–2 people, 1 bath)$2,300$4,200$2,300$4,200
7–9 GPM (2–3 people, 2 baths)$2,650$4,900$2,650$4,900
9–11 GPM (3–4 people, 2–3 baths)$3,050$5,400$3,050$5,400
11+ GPM (5+ people / whole-home)$3,550$5,850$3,550$5,850

Best time to buy

Cheapest time for tankless water heater installation in either city

Why winter is expensive: it's failure season, when cold groundwater stresses old units and emergency calls flood in. A 10+ year-old tank replaced proactively, before it dies, skips that spike completely.

Tank or tankless — and what should you budget?

Tank, tankless or heat-pump — the format you pick shapes the bill today and the utility bill for years after. Our editors weigh the trade-offs.

The tankless case

Going tankless means paying more at install — often for a resized gas line or a dedicated electrical circuit — in exchange for hot water that never runs dry and a unit that outlives two conventional tanks. Dropping the standby loss of a constantly reheated reservoir trims the monthly bill on top of that. It fits a full house that isn't selling anytime soon.

The simple-swap case

If your current tank suits your household and the budget is tight, a like-for-like tank replacement is the cheapest, fastest job — no gas-line or panel upgrades, done in a morning.

The heat-pump case

For the lowest running cost of the three, the heat-pump water heater wins outright, and where utilities offer incentives the rebates behind it are the richest available. You pay for that advantage up front, and the unit needs the right home — a warm, well-ventilated area with real clearance. Wedge it into a tight closet and the savings disappear.

Our take

There's no universally "best" water heater — only the one that fits your budget and timeline. Tight budget, go tank; want endless hot water, go tankless; optimizing for the lowest bill, go heat-pump.
